Best Place in Texas
I love this little valley town in way West Texas. They nickname themselves “The Real Final Frontier” and they are definatly that. It seems like it’s in the middle of nowhere but the beauty of it makes it worth any other pains of being there. It about 100 miles north of Big Bend National Park, which is another place I love, and sits quite quaintly below the Mountain the locals call the Twin Sisters, it’s real name is the Twin Peaks. But there are several places around Alpine worth visiting too. But there’s just something about Alpine that makes it special, I’m not quite sure why.
Also, there is a small college located there called Sul Ross, so any of you prospective Veternarians that need to find a good college to go to. I suggest it if you’re wanting to get away from the big city hustle and bustle for a few years or even to live there, if you don’t mind having to travel about 100 miles to get to the nearest Wal-Mart.
But again, the beauty outweighs any unpleastantries of living or staying there. I’ll always wish to at least visit this part of Texas, if it’s not to live there.
